Does Mod Organizer mess where Papyrus logs are saved?


GSDFan

Question

JarlBrogruf on the Nexus forums asked:

Does this mod mess with where my papyrus log is saved? I haven't gotten a new log since.

As far as I can tell, the Papyrus log location is not moved or changed by Mod Organizer, v1.0.7 rc8, but depending on how you create your profile the Papyrus logs will be disabled.

 

When creating a new profile you have an option, via check box, to use “Default Game Settingsâ€. If that box is checked MO will ignore the configuration files in Documents\my games\skyrim and create a set of clean or canned configuration files in the profile.

 

I suggest you look at Skyrim.ini in the ini editor and see if Papyrus logging has been disabled.

 

 

 

Papyrus Disabled

fPostLoadUpdateTimeMS=500.0

bEnableLogging=0

bEnableTrace=0

bLoadDebugInformation=0
